#b67ffe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b67ffe is composed of 71.4% red, 49.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 266 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 74.7%. #b67ffe color hex could be obtained by blending #fffeff with #6d00f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b67ffe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040008 is the darkest color, while #f9f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b67ffe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ebbc2 is the less saturated color, while #b67ffe is the most saturated one.
